Wikipedia’s Plan to Thrive in the AI Era

On Monday, Wikipedia unveiled a strategic plan to safeguard its future in the age of artificial intelligence, despite facing a decline in website traffic. The Wikimedia Foundation, the entity behind the renowned online encyclopedia, urged AI developers to responsibly utilize its content by ensuring proper attribution and accessing it through the paid service known as the Wikimedia Enterprise platform.

The Wikimedia Enterprise platform is a subscription-based service that enables businesses to leverage Wikipedia’s vast content without overloading the organization’s servers. By opting for this paid product, AI companies can actively contribute to Wikipedia’s nonprofit mission, supporting its sustainability and growth.

While Wikipedia refrained from imposing penalties or legal repercussions for unauthorized use of its material through web scraping, it recently detected a surge in bot activity on its platform. These AI bots, attempting to mimic human behavior, significantly inflated Wikipedia’s traffic figures in May and June. Consequently, the organization observed an 8% decline in authentic human page views year-over-year.

With these developments in mind, Wikipedia has established clear guidelines for AI developers and providers. It emphasizes the importance of attributing content to acknowledge the human contributors responsible for creating the information used by generative AI systems. This approach not only fosters transparency but also encourages users to engage with the primary sources of information.

“In order for internet users to trust the information they encounter online, platforms must be transparent about the sources of their content and promote direct engagement with those sources,” the Wikimedia Foundation stated. The post further underscores the critical role of user visits, volunteer contributions, and donor support in sustaining Wikipedia’s operations.

Earlier this year, Wikipedia introduced its AI strategy for editors, affirming its commitment to leveraging artificial intelligence to enhance editor workflows and streamline labor-intensive tasks. The goal is to empower editors with innovative tools that complement their efforts rather than replace their invaluable contributions.
